    Abstract: An automatic gain control (AGC) circuit and method for performing AGC for an orthogonal frequency-division multiplexing (OFDM) receiver measures signal power of input digital signals that are derived from incoming data frames with preambles to produce gain change signals when the signal power differs from a reference target power level. The gain of an amplifier of the OFDM receiver is changed in response to the gain change signals until a preamble of the data frames is detected for the first time. The gain of the amplifier of the OFDM receiver is further changed in response to the gain change signals, after the preamble is detected, only during periods when the preambles of the data frames are being processed by the OFDM receiver such that the gain of the amplifier is not changed during periods when other portions of the data frames are being processed by the OFDM receiver.

    Abstract: An OFDM-based device and method for performing synchronization utilizes a time-domain preamble of an incoming OFDM-based signal to compute an estimated fine frequency offset. The computation of the estimated fine frequency offset involves multiplying values of the time-domain preamble with conjugates of corresponding values of a selected base station time-domain preamble, averaging the resulting multiplied values in predefined segments and self-correlating the resulting averaged values to derive a self-correlation value, which is used to compute the estimated fine frequency offset.

    Abstract: A device and method for performing a channel profile estimation for an OFDM-based wireless communication system uses an averaged frequency coherence metric to select a particular channel profile, which is a current channel profile estimate. The averaged frequency coherence metric is derived using correlations between pilot subcarriers of an OFDM-based signal at predefined subcarrier locations for multiple frames of the OFDM-based signal. The selected channel profile may be used for channel estimation, as well as for link adaptation, to improve the performance of these processes.

    Abstract: A device and method for performing a channel estimation for an OFDM-based wireless communication system using sparsely spaced pilot subcarriers estimates missing pilot subcarriers in an interpolation window using pilot subcarriers that are outside of the interpolation window to produce estimated pilot subcarriers for the interpolation window. The pilot subcarriers in the interpolation window and the estimated pilot subcarrier are used to compute pilot channel estimates for the interpolation window, which are then used to derive data channel estimates for the interpolation window.

    Abstract: A soft-bit de-mapping device and method of generating soft bits for decoding quantizes a log-likelihood ratio (LLR) value for a received value using functions bits and channel parameter bits to generate the soft bits. The function bits are generated by quantizing an LLR function for the received value, which includes modifying an original curve of the LLR function to a modified curve such that a segment of the original curve with the lowest slope is protected in the modified curve for a fixed equal quantization step-size. The channel parameter bits are generated by quantizing a channel parameter for the received value to generate channel.

    Abstract: A stepper motor device uses compensating non-sinusoidal driving values to compensate for operational non-sinusoidal drive characteristics of a motor of the device due to at least design and manufacturing imperfections in the motor. The compensating non-sinusoidal driving values may be derived using back electromagnetic force produced from the motor or using measured rotational positions of the motor when the motor is driven using known driving values.
